What is Enterprise Insurance?
Commercial insurance is a broad term covering multiple types of policies that protect businesses, owners, and staff from economic losses.
It includes coverage for claims, asset protection, employee coverage, and more.
Common Types of Commercial Insurance in Aurora CO:
- Comprehensive Liability Protection – Protects against external claims of customer injuries, infrastructure harm, or litigation fees.
- Commercial Property Insurance – Covers business property like offices, goods, and machinery from accidental damage, theft, or disasters.
- Business Owners Policy (BOP) – A bundled policy combining core coverage and facility protection at a discounted rate.
- Workers’ Compensation Insurance – Covers health costs and pay replacement for team members injured on the job.
- Industry-Specific Protection – Protects against allegations of negligence or contract breaches in professional services.
- Commercial Auto Insurance – Covers transportation assets used for commercial use.
- Digital Security Coverage – Protects against confidentiality failures, cyber attacks, and cyber threats.
How Much Does manufacturing business insurance in Aurora CO Cost?
The cost of enterprise insurance varies based on factors such as:
- Business Type – Sectors prone to liability (industrial work, freight) pay more than low-risk businesses (consulting, hospitality).
- Operating Region – Government mandates, crime rates, and weather risks can affect pricing.
- Workforce Size – Increased income and larger workforce mean expanded liability.
- Policy Caps – Policies with expanded liability protection cost more but provide stronger protection.
